Abstract
In this paper the syntax of the functions of the packages Clifford.m and Nabla.m is explained by means of simple examples. These files together with some examples mostly taken from physical applications are meant to be an integral part of the software developed by the authors. Also included is a MatLab appendix referring to another specific set of files.
